What fantastic start to a day! A few weeks ago I blogged about flying over Mt. Rainer with one of my clients in his new plane! This week’s image was taken during that exciting ride! It was about 7:45am and the sun had just hit the mountain. This was a once in a lifetime shot, Mt. Rainer at 16,000ft with Mt. St. Helens in the background! –TECH. INFO.- Fuji S5, 18mm Nikor Lens, ISO 100, 250th of a Sec. @ 9.5. I shot it at 250th to minimize the movement of the plane; we were going about 300 knots. I also used our fine art “Truce” effect to enhance the image’s artistry. Check out St. Helens in the background, well, what’s left of it. Enjoy!
